THEY are known as the deadly double act of culinary culture.

Now comics Steve Coogan and Rob Brydon are set to take a journey down south as part of a brand new TV series.

For the third course of their TV comedy The Trip they are set to visit Andalucia, as well as the Basque Region, Cantabria, Aragon, Rioja and Castile La Mancha.

The six-part series will feature the duo’s alter-egos bickering, doing impressions and sampling Spain’s finest food (including manchego cheese and jamon, no doubt).

Filming will start later this year with exact destinations being kept closely under wraps for now.

“Having thought long and hard about yet another sojourn into culinary distractions and middle age, I have reluctantly agreed to Eviva Espana,” Coogan revealed.

The first two editions of director Michael Winterbottom’s programme featured the comic actors driving through northern England and then Italy.

The last series aired on BBC Two more than three years ago, but Sky Atlantic have now snapped up the popular show.

“I’m looking forward to reuniting with Steve and Michael for The Trip to Spain,” said Brydon.

“Same format? Same jokes!”
